Eating at Blossoms

New seasonal menus

As one of the best restaurants in Rutland, we’re delighted to have launched our delicious new seasonal menu at Rutland Hall Hotel, curated by our passionate Executive Head Chef, Sumit Chakrabarty.

This menu comes in a variety of formats with the most exciting offer being driven by the on-site restaurant, Blossoms’, new set lunch menu which is a steal at just £26 for 2 courses, and £28 for 3 courses. Other lunch options include nibbles and sharing platters, and a light lunch menu offering sandwiches, burgers, salads and pizzas.

“This latest menu is close to my heart,” explains Chef. “I call it refined dining, where I get to champion fresh and seasonal local produce. Blossoms’ latest menus are all about celebrating flavours; we are proud to be serving exceptionally tasty dishes that are not too fussy in style using seasonal produce.”

The ever-popular Blossoms restaurant has an outstanding reputation for fantastic dining experiences, offering something for all tastes.

Menu options

Served 7 days a week Between 12 noon and 9pm

The highlight of our menus is, of course, the evening menu which offers a unique selection of delicious dishes including super slow cooked English beef, pan-fried wild stone bass, and lamb Osso Bucco rogan josh. All dishes are freshly prepared using local produce wherever possible.

The starter and dessert menus offer an array of tastes designed to appeal to all tastes. Starters include goats cheese tarte tatin, truffled wild mushroom arancini, lemongrass infused Scottish salmon and cajun spiced corn fritters. Desserts are traditional in style with a modern twist: including a tasty traditional apple crumble option (served in a tartlet style), a rich dark chocolate tiramisu, mulled wine poached pear and an intensely fruity blackberry cheesecake.

All menus include vegetarian, vegan and gluten free options, and all dietary requirements can be accommodated with prior notice.

Jurassic Afternoon Tea Come and have ‘roar-some’ fun

Book a Jurassic Afternoon Tea box and treat your children to a fun and interactive meal where they get to decorate and devour dinosaur biscuits that come as part of a fossil-themed meal.

A Jurassic Afternoon Tea costs £20 and comes served in a dinosaur themed box that’s filled with 2 x sandwiches (1 x cheese, 1 x ham), a sausage roll, cup cake, chocolate brownie and a dinosaur shaped shortbread biscuit. A set of icing pens is also included so that children can decorate their own biscuits. How delicious is that?

In addition, all Jurassic Afternoon Tea orders will be served will be served with a special A5 booklet packed with fun facts, a winning story written by a local school girl (Phoebe, aged 7 at the time of writing), called The Beast of Rutland, and a fossil word search.

Refined International Cuisine

Leading the culinary team is Executive Head Chef Sumit Chakrabarty who has reinvigorated the food offering at Blossoms to cement it as one of the region’s memorable dining moments. A true visionary in his field, Sumit has brought a wealth of expertise and knowledge to the Blossoms team, having worked in several Michelin-star establishments with some of the best chefs in the world. 

With a commitment to exceptional food quality, all of the dishes served at Blossoms are beautifully presented and are cooked from scratch using fresh and local ingredients.
